TP Wallet最新版:触发智能合约的安全、去中心化身份与动态验证全景分析

随着TP Wallet持续迭代,最新版在“触发智能合约”的体验上更强调可用性与合规化的交互流程:从签名、路由、参数校验到执行反馈,链上动作更像被“编排”成可控的链上指令。本文围绕你提出的五个维度——安全网络防护、去中心化身份、市场未来趋势预测、智能化金融应用、持久性、动态验证——做综合分析,并讨论其背后的工程与治理逻辑。

一、安全网络防护:把攻击面压到最小

1)交易与签名链路防护:智能合约触发的核心是“用户意图->交易数据->链上执行”。TP Wallet最新版通常会在交互层减少用户误操作空间:例如对关键字段(合约地址、方法选择器、参数、gas上限、链ID)做更明确的呈现与校验,降低“钓鱼合约/错误网络”导致的资产风险。

2)权限与授权控制:触发类操作往往伴随代币授权、合约调用权限。安全策略应包含:

- 默认最小权限授权(尽量避免无限授权);

- 对授权范围进行可视化(合约地址、额度、到期策略);

- 在触发前做二次确认,尤其是高风险函数(mint、transferFrom大额、delegatecall相关等)。

3)网络层与对抗能力:在去中心化环境中,网络防护不仅是“服务器安全”,更要考虑:恶意RPC、回放攻击、链重组引发的状态不一致、以及MEV/抢跑带来的执行偏差。可行做法包括:

- 多源RPC校验交易回执;

- 对关键状态查询做一致性判断;

- 对敏感交易采用更稳健的确认策略(例如等待足够确认数再判定成功)。

4)合约风险与参数校验:钱包侧无法替代合约审计,但能减少误传参数:例如对参数类型、长度、单位(token decimals)、精度进行校验;对路径类参数(swap route)进行规则限制或提示。

二、去中心化身份:让“触发者”更可验证

去中心化身份(DID/VC范式或钱包身份标签)在“触发智能合约”场景中越来越重要:因为钱包不仅是签名工具,更是身份与权限的载体。可能的实现路径包括:

1)链上身份锚定:将用户身份与链上地址、ENS/域名解析、或可验证凭证(VC)进行绑定,使“是谁在触发”与“以什么权限触发”可追溯。

2)隐私与可证明性并存:在不暴露过多个人信息的前提下,使用可验证凭证表达资格或风险分层(例如KYC过的程度、资金来源证明的类型、设备可信度声明)。

3)跨链一致性:TP Wallet若面向多链,身份锚定需要跨链策略:要么在目标链上复用同一身份锚点,要么通过标准化凭证在不同链验证。

结论:DID并非为了“集中式认证”,而是让链上交互更可验证,减少冒用与误导交易。

三、市场未来趋势预测:从“钱包”走向“智能交易编排器”

1)触发从单笔走向组合:未来更常见的是“多步骤合约触发”——例如借贷、换仓、质押、保险、再平衡一体化执行。TP Wallet最新版的价值会体现在:把复杂交易编排做成更直观的意图层。

2)风险分级与合规化交互:随着监管与用户教育并行,钱包侧将更注重“风险提示、权限控制、授权到期与撤回”。合规不是由链外中心决定,而是通过可审计与可验证机制降低违规概率。

3)更强的动态路由与执行策略:市场竞争会推动钱包在路由选择、gas策略、滑点估算方面更智能,以提升成交率并降低MEV影响。

4)账户抽象(Account Abstraction)趋势:AA使“触发合约”更像触发一个代理账户的意图,能把复杂签名、nonce管理、批量执行封装起来,从而改善用户体验并减少错误。

四、智能化金融应用:把合约变成“金融工作流”

在智能化金融应用方面,触发智能合约正在走向“自动化金融工单”:

1)自动做市与交易策略:钱包与聚合器协同,根据链上流动性动态触发交换或再平衡。

2)DeFi资产管理:通过触发合约实现再投资、收益分配、风险阈值触发(例如健康度低于阈值自动减仓或补仓)。

3)链上信用与条件触发:在满足条件时才触发合约(例如抵押达到某阈值、利率变动到区间、价格预言机验证通过)。

4)支付与结算升级:把付款从“转账”变成“带条件的执行”,例如跨链结算、分期释放、里程碑式付款。

关键点:智能化金融的落地不仅靠合约算法,也依赖钱包的意图呈现、参数校验与动态验证能力。

五、持久性:让“意图”在时间维度上可信

你提出“持久性”可从两层理解:

1)用户层面的持久性:当用户发出触发意图后,应有可持续的状态追踪与告知机制:交易挂起、重试、部分失败、链上回滚等都需要被清晰记录。钱包应提供可追踪日志与明确的失败原因分类,而不是只给“成功/失败”的二元结果。

2)协议层面的持久性:合约调用依赖外部数据(价格、路由、gas等)。为保证长期可用性,应减少对单点脆弱依赖,采用多源预言机/冗余路径,或对关键参数引入容错机制。

此外,持久性还涉及“授权长期风险”:如果授权设置过久且权限过大,会导致长期暴露。更合理的是到期授权、可撤回授权、或细粒度额度。

六、动态验证:让每次触发都“当场被证明”

动态验证强调:在触发智能合约之前与之后,对关键条件进行实时校验。

1)前置动态校验(Pre-check):

- 网络与链ID确认:防止在错误链上签名;

- 合约代码哈希/接口兼容性检查:避免接口变化或假合约;

- 参数风险校验:金额、滑点、路径、接收地址等;

- 预估结果与边界提示:例如预估最小可得数量(minOut)与预期偏差。

2)执行后动态验证(Post-check):

- 事件回执解析:确认合约是否按预期触发(事件与状态变量一致性);

- 状态差异校验:对关键余额变化做二次核对;

- 重组/延迟处理:对“先看成功后失败”的链上波动,进行延迟确认策略与二次校验。

3)持续监控:当用户授权或发起高风险策略时,钱包可提供持续监控与告警(例如授权余额超阈、健康度下降、价格触发但条件未满足等)。

结论:动态验证是把智能合约从“黑箱执行”变为“可核验执行”的关键步骤。

综合来看,TP Wallet最新版在触发智能合约的体验提升背后,核心是三件事:

- 用安全网络防护缩小攻击面;

- 用去中心化身份与可验证凭证增强可追溯与权限治理;

- 用动态验证与持久性机制把用户意图在时间与状态上“持续可信”。

当市场从单笔交易走向组合工作流,智能化金融应用将成为更主流的形态;而真正决定用户体验与资金安全的,正是钱包能否把复杂性封装为可核验、可回溯、可控制的触发流程。

作者:林岚链研发布时间:2026-05-03 00:46:08

评论

MinaWei

动态验证这块讲得很到位:前置校验+执行后核对,能明显降低“看似成功实则偏离预期”的风险。

链上旅行者

持久性和授权到期结合起来考虑,是很多文章没提到的点。长期风险确实更可怕。

NovaZed

我喜欢你把去中心化身份和权限治理放在同一条逻辑链上,能看出钱包不只是签名工具。

XiaoYuJ

关于MEV/抢跑的提法很实用,希望后续能补充更具体的应对策略。

AvaSatoshi

市场趋势预测那段很像路线图:从单笔到编排,从交易到工作流。

MarcoLiu

安全网络防护不仅是RPC问题,还包括链重组与回执一致性,这个视角加分。

相关阅读